Landmarks and Surroundings
The area around Pure Markt is filled with nature, local culture, and timeless Amsterdam beauty. Here are some must-see spots nearby that keep the city’s authentic spirit alive:
- Frankendael Park – The most famous home of Pure Markt. A peaceful park with canals, picnic spots, and historic buildings that give a glimpse of old Amsterdam.
- Amstelpark – A wide, green park perfect for walks and cycling, with small art gardens and local events happening throughout the year.
- Amsterdamse Bos – A huge forest-like park on the edge of the city. Locals come here for canoeing, open-air concerts, and weekend relaxation.
- Huize Frankendael – A stunning 18th-century house turned cultural space, offering art exhibitions and a beautiful restaurant for travelers looking for a local meal.
Transportation
Getting to Pure Markt locations is simple and smooth, even for first-time visitors. Amsterdam’s public transport system is reliable and easy to use, making travel to each market spot quick and affordable.
- Tram Lines – Trams 9 and 19 take you close to Frankendael Park, while trams 4 and 25 can reach Amstelpark with ease.
- Metro Access – The Amsterdam RAI and Amstel metro stations are nearby and connect well with other city districts.
- Cycling – Biking remains the best way to experience Amsterdam. Dedicated lanes lead directly to all Pure Markt venues, and rentals are available everywhere.
